The Rise of AI and Automation

You’ve probably heard a lot about artificial intelligence lately, right? Well, AI is becoming a huge part of data science. We’re not just talking about self-driving cars (though that’s pretty cool too), but more about smarter tools that can analyse data faster than ever before.


Imagine programs that can clean, organize, and even visualize data for you automatically. This means that instead of getting stuck on tedious tasks, you can focus on the interesting stuff—like finding patterns and making decisions that matter.


Real-Time Data Is the New Black

Have you ever wondered how apps like weather trackers or stock market apps get their updates almost instantly? That’s real-time data processing in action. The future is all about getting insights in real time. This is going to revolutionise industries like finance, healthcare, and retail. Whether it’s predicting a sudden change in the market or alerting doctors about a patient’s health in real time, faster data processing means better, quicker decisions.

Data Ethics and Privacy: A Growing Conversation

As data becomes more powerful, there’s also a bigger conversation happening around ethics and privacy. We all love cool tech, but we also want our personal info to be safe, right? Expect to see more discussions—and probably stricter regulations—on how data is collected, used, and shared. Being responsible with data isn’t just a buzzword; it’s becoming a must-have skill for every data scientist.


Blending Disciplines for Innovative Solutions

Data science isn’t staying in its lane. It’s teaming up with fields like biology, environmental science, and even art! For example, bioinformatics is using data science to help decode genetic information, and environmental scientists are using data models to predict climate change.


The best part? This kind of interdisciplinary work means there are endless possibilities for creative and impactful projects.
